Output 405630f3567a623ebba83bb90b42d217b5359c49f454c74b3b4480ffe8e71c6e:5

value
2379
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a35e685e0bf6ea64d93896c5a8b94e977da58ddd2f82c6e5ea4d26f6a85cd586
address
bc1p5d0xshst7m4xfkfcjmz63w2wja76trwa97pvde02f5n0d2zu6krqchhta8
transaction
405630f3567a623ebba83bb90b42d217b5359c49f454c74b3b4480ffe8e71c6e
confirmations
77935
spent
true